Paddle and Trail celebrates second anniversary with community events

Paddle and Trail is celebrating its second anniversary by hosting a free open house at the Regional Activity Center in Loves Park 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. on Saturday, Sept. 1. The public will have the opportunity to try out kayaks and stand-up paddleboards and fish for free.

Sunday, Sept. 2, they continue the celebration with “Celebrate Rockford Day,” starting with a Breakfast Paddle to the Burpee at 8:30 a.m., and visiting the Rick’s Picks exhibit at the Burpee. The festivities continue later in the afternoon at the Milliennium Center, 220 S. Madison St., Rockford at 3 p.m. with a free reception featuring guest speaker Frank Schier speaking about the “Rock River Trail Initiative.” The winner of the “Gear Up. Head Out. Photo Contest” will also be announced. After the reception, guests are invited to head over to enjoy the On the Waterfront music festival.
